什么是UTC?

UTC,全称是协调世界时(Coordinated Universal Time),是在全球范围内的时间标准。它不是一种时区,而是为了方便全球沟通而设立的统一时间。UTC结合了原子时间和天文时间,使得时间的定义更加精确和一致。想象一下,如果没有统一的时间标准,我们的跨国交流、航运、飞行,甚至日常生活都会变得混乱不堪。在区块链技术中,UTC的定义同样至关重要,它帮助确保数据的一致性和可靠性。

区块链与UTC的关系

深入理解区块链中的UTC:定义及重要性

那么,在区块链的世界中,UTC究竟扮演了怎样的角色呢?区块链是一种去中心化的分布式记账技术,其核心优势在于数据的透明性和不可篡改性。而为了实现这些优点,时间的准确记录便显得尤为重要。简而言之,区块链中的每一笔交易都会被时间戳所标记,这个时间戳通常是以UTC时间为依据的。

例如,当你在某个区块链平台上进行一次交易时,系统会生成一个时间戳,标记这笔交易的发生时间。由于这个时间是基于UTC的,因此无论这笔交易是在纽约、东京还是伦敦进行的,所有人都可以清晰地了解到这笔交易的准确时间。这样的机制不仅提升了交易的透明度,还降低了可能出现的争议。

UTC在区块链中的重要性

在区块链应用中,UTC的作用是不可或缺的。以下是几点关键的重要性:

  • 防止双重支付:双重支付是数字货币交易中常见的问题,UTC时间戳的引入可以有效帮助解决这一难题。当交易被记录时,系统会依据UTC时间顺序来处理,从而避免了同一笔资金被重复使用的可能性。
  • 增强可验证性:在许多区块链应用中,时间戳成为了验证交易有效性的关键因素。用户可以通过查询交易的UTC时间来确认其是否在特定时间内完成。
  • 提升智能合约的效率:智能合约是区块链中的一项革命性技术,其执行依赖于特定条件。UTC时间戳可以作为触发条件的一部分,让智能合约在预定时间自动执行。

如何在区块链中获取UTC时间?

深入理解区块链中的UTC:定义及重要性

如果你对如何在区块链中获取UTC时间感兴趣,那么一定不要错过以下几种方式:

  • 通过API接口:许多区块链平台或提供商会开放API接口,让开发者在程序中轻松调用UTC时间。这种方式适合开发者在构建应用程序时使用。
  • 区块链浏览器:许多区块链都有专门的浏览器,允许用户查看历史交易记录及其对应的UTC时间。用户可以在区块链浏览器中搜索特定的交易来获取更为详尽的信息。
  • 直接查询区块信息:在大多数区块链中,每一个区块都有一个时间戳字段,用户可以直接查询这些区块的信息以获取相关的UTC时间。

常见问题解答

在了解了UTC在区块链中的重要性及其操作方式后,很多人不免会产生一些额外的问题。以下是两个常见且重要的问题以及详细的解答。

1. 为什么区块链不使用当地时间?

这是一个非常好的问题。在区块链的全球化背景下,各个国家和地区都有不同的时区和夏令时制度,如果每个交易都采用当地时间来记录,将会导致严重的混淆与纠纷。例如,美国的某个交易如果使用东部时间,而亚洲的某个交易使用的是当地时间,那么在进行交叉验证时,两者的时间便会出现差异。

而UTC时间的使用则在根本上避免了这个问题。它为所有的交易提供了一个共同的标准,无论你身处哪个城市、哪个国家,都能通过UTC时间来确认事件的发生顺序和时间。这种统一性使得区块链在全球范围内的运作变得更加高效与可信。

2. 未来区块链领域中UTC会有什么变化吗?

展望未来,UTC在区块链中的应用会继续演变并变得更加智能。随着技术的不断进步,区块链网络可能会引入更加复杂的时间管理机制,例如集成多种时间来源或者根据区块链应用场景的不同,允许用户自定义时间戳的格式。

此外,随着区块链技术在金融、物流、医疗等多领域的深入应用,时间的精确性和即时性将越来越受到重视。未来的区块链应用可能会结合物联网和人工智能技术,实时更新和验证UTC时间,从而提升系统的可靠性与响应速度。

结论

在区块链的世界中,UTC的重要性不仅体现在时间的统一性上,更在于它为整个系统提供了一种可依赖的背景。在全球化日益加深的今天,协作和信任的建立显得尤为重要,UTC无疑为这一目标的实现奠定了基础。无论你是区块链爱好者、开发者,还是普通用户,了解UTC在区块链中的应用无疑会为你带来更多的视野和思考。

希望本文能够让你对"区块链UTC"有更深入的了解!如果你还有更多问题或想法,欢迎与你的朋友讨论,共同探讨这一个引人入胜的数字世界。